IC 4684 - Reflection Nebula in Sagittarius

Above the horizon.  Rise: 18:24 | Tran: 23:32 | Set: 4:40
Alt: 30.58°   Az: 215.31°   Direction: South-West

IC 4684 is a Reflection Nebula in the Sagittarius constellation. IC 4684 is situated close to the celestial equator and, as such, it is at least partly visible from both hemispheres in certain times of the year.
